    When doing multi-line notes the block syntax is worth mentioning /* */, or just type a bunch of text, select it and hit Ctrl + / (on a UK keyboard) to toggle comments.

    • @HavensConsulting
      @HavensConsulting  2 місяці тому

      Anyone with build permissions who could do self-service reporting can see the descriptions when hovering over the fields.
      For people just looking at the report. They wouldn't want to look at the fields list. If you need extra notes for them. The visual header Help tooltip is my recommendation, adds a custom tooltip description, per visual/object on the report page :)
